How do I Disassemble an Amana Microwave Door?

Disassemble the oven door of your Amana microwave oven when the door is damaged and needs replacement parts. Does this Spark an idea?

Things You'll Need

  • Thin metal ruler
  • Phillips screwdriver

Instructions

    • 1

      Unplug the microwave oven. Open the microwave oven door. Use a Phillips screwdriver to remove the screw holding the top corner hinge on the chassis of the microwave oven. Lift up on the door with one hand underneath the door and the other hand on top of the door and pull the door from the chassis.

    • 2

      Remove any screws from the top, side and bottom of the edge of the door with a Phillips screwdriver and set them aside. Place the edge of a thin metal ruler in the crevice at the top of the door between the outer door frame and the inner door cover that is positioned between the door frame and the glass on the inside of the door. Run the ruler along the crevice and gently move the ruler up until the inner door cover moves away from the door.

    • 3

      Continue to move the ruler along the entire crevice and pry all sides of the bezel away from the door frame. Pull the bezel from the door frame.

    • 4

      Remove the screws that secure the handle to the door using a Phillips screwdriver and set the screws aside. Remove the handle bracket and the handle from the door. Remove the screws from the outer edge of the inside door plate using a Phillips screwdriver and remove the inside door plate. Remove the glass and set aside.
